2.To what common objects would the scaled Sun and planets be similar in size? (Hint: You might want to convert the meters to inches if it helps you visualize the sizes of the scaled planets. One meter equals 39.37 inches)

The Sun can be compared to a watermelon, Mercury to a dill seed, Venus to a coriander seed, Earth to a peppercorn, Mars to a sesame seed, Jupiter to a plum, Saturn to a walnut. Uranus to a grape, and finally Neptune to a hazelnut.
